Illumina unveils a distributed whole-genome MRD research solution for oncology, leveraging NovaSeq X to enable solid tumor and blood cancer profiling. The end-to-end workflow promises results in about five days with sensitivity as low as 10 ppm and 99.5% analytical specificity. Early evaluators like Mayo Clinic and a BMS-ASCO collaboration indicate growing adoption potential.

Key Facts

  • Illumina launches distributed WGS MRD solution for oncology research.
  • Targets solid tumors and blood cancers with early access partners.
  • 5-day end-to-end workflow; 10 ppm sensitivity; 99.5% analytical specificity.
  • NovaSeq X advancements enable ultra-sensitive MRD detection under development.
  • ASCO poster with Bristol Myers Squibb; Mayo Clinic evaluating the approach.
